Giuseppe Vasi (Corleone,1710 - Rome, 1782) was an engraver, architect, and landscape artist. Between 1746 and 1761, Vasi published 10 volumes with 240 engravings of the monuments of Rome. Among his students, there was Giovanni Battista Piranesi. Vasi's goal was to represent the Rome of his time. Vasi studied architecture as well so that he was able to represent the monuments of Rome with precision and in much detail.
